渲的组词组什么词(探究渲染的奥秘)
探究渲染的奥秘
了解渲染
我们熟知的浏览器渲染,是指将HTML、CSS、JavaScript等网页文本转换为我们能看得到的视觉内容的过程。那么,渲染是怎样实现的呢?首先,浏览器将HTML解析为DOM树,将CSS解析为样式表规则,然后将它们合并为渲染树,最后通过渲染器在屏幕上显示出来。值得注意的是,浏览器渲染的效果与网页的HTML、CSS等代码是分离的,我们可以通过改变CSS或JavaScript来控制渲染的结果,这就是所谓的前端开发。深入分析渲染规则
在这个过程中,渲染器如何根据渲染树和具体的设备特性来进行渲染呢?举个例子,比如对于CSS的样式,渲染器会根据CSS级联规则和特殊性来计算出每个元素的最终样式,然后再将其应用到渲染树上。同时,还需要考虑到具体的设备特性,如窗口大小、像素密度等,以便让渲染的结果更加符合我们的实际需求。除此之外,渲染器还需要处理诸如字体渲染、图像加载等一系列问题,以便呈现一个完整的网页。优化渲染的方法
虽然浏览器的渲染过程非常复杂,但我们仍然可以通过一些方法来提高渲染的性能和效率。比如,我们可以通过减小DOM和渲染树的复杂度,避免过多的DOM嵌套和层级,或者通过使用CSS的transform和opacity属性等技术来减少不必要的DOM操作,以此优化网页的性能。此外,我们还可以通过预加载图片、使用Web Worker等技术,进一步提高网页的渲染速度和用户体验。通过这些方法来优化我们的网页渲染,进而提高网页的价值和竞争力。本文内容来自互联网,请自行判断内容的正确性。若本站收录的内容无意侵犯了贵司版权,且有疑问请给我们来信,我们会及时处理和回复。 转载请注明出处: http://www.bjdwkgd.com/baike/19647.html 渲的组词组什么词(探究渲染的奥秘)